The Green Bay Packers are 3-0 after their first three games and the defense has been the driving force behind all of those wins. Jaire Alexander is in his second NFL season and has been viewed as one of the top up-and-coming defensive stars in the league.

Pro Football Focus has taken notice of the performances that Alexander has put together. They also have him as their highest-rated cornerback in the league.

Alexander has been very vocal about his thoughts on Green Bay's defense. He has boldly stated that the Packers have the NFL's best defense. From looking at the numbers and performances, he certainly has an argument that can support that.

Through the first three games of the season, Alexander has racked up 15 total tackles to go along with a forced fumble, a fumble recovery, and six defended passes. Those numbers show why he sits atop the rankings from Pro Football Focus. He also has had multiple opportunities to record interceptions.

Green Bay will now face off against the Philadelphia Eagles on Thursday Night Football. Alexander will need to come through with another big game to slow down Carson Wentz and the weapons he has. It won't be an easy matchup for the Packers.

Pettine has utilized Alexander perfectly so far this season. He also has an excellent partner across the field from him in Kevin King. For the first time in a long time, the secondary is a strength for the Packers.

Alexander is just getting started and has a lot more potential to reach for, which should be a scary thought for opposing offenses moving forward this season.
